Abstract(in English) | Temperature distribution measurement along a superconducting wire was demonstrated to detect quench behavior utilizing wavelength division multiplexed fiber Bragg gratings (FBGs). The FBGs were directly attached on the wire to measure actual wire temperature during the quenching. Quench and its propagation were successfully detected by measuring temperature increase on each grating. It was also possible to evaluate quench propagation velocity, temperature increasing rate and the highest temperature occurred at the superconducting wire. |
